NFC Award to be approved on multiple factors basis: Shazia

09 May, 2009

The Sindh Minister for Information Shazia Marrie has said that equitable distribution of the resources was the only solution of the confronting socio-economic problems and development of the province, as such the PPP government has determined to get NFC Award approved on the basis of multiple factors.
This she said while talking to the journalists at the Committee Room of DCO office Jamshoro on Friday. She said that it is established fact that Sindh Province was contributing 65 percent but getting 23.71 percent revenue shares from the Federal Government that has weakened the financial position of the province and gave birth to many problems.
Shazia Marrie said that previously the provinces had been getting 80 percent share from the NFC Award but in 1996 then caretaker government reversed the formula of NFC Award and the share of the provinces was reduced from 80 percent to 37.5 percent and added that it was unjustified and needed to be revised on the basis of multiple factors rather than population factor.

Replying to a question, she made it clear that during the PPP government, Kala Bagh Dam will not be constructed. She termed the Kala Bagh Dam as technically dangerous project for the small provinces who had already rejected it through their Assemblies and added that the finding of ANG Abbasi Commission had also rejected this project.
She said that the Federal Minister for Water and Power did not support this project but he still stands with the view point of small provinces.
